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K filing by GlaxoSmithKline plc (GSK) serves as a notification to the Securities and Exchange Commission regarding the submission of its Annual Report 2010 on Form 20-F. The filing was made on March 4, 2011, and covers the fiscal year ended December 31, 2010. The report includes audited financial statements for the specified period.

Important Facts for Investors to Verify
- The audited financ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2010, are contained in the Form 20-F filed on March 4, 2011.
- The Annual Report 2010 is available online at www.gsk.com/corporatereporting and www.sec.gov.
- Hard copies of the Annual Report and the Notice of Annual General Meeting were expected to be available on or about March 21, 2011.
- Shareholders may request free hard copies of the audited financial statements via Equiniti (UK), BNY Mellon Shareowner Services (US), or the GSK Response Center (US).
